KTET Result 2021: Kerala Education Board has declared the KTET Result 2021 on the official website and the direct link to download the result can be accessed here. To download the KTET 2021 Result, candidates will be required to enter their roll number.

KTET 2021 was held on 31st August 2021 for KTET I and 1st September 2021 for KTET II and on 3rd September 2021 for KTET III and KTET IV.

Check Kerala TET Result 2021 Here

KTET 2021 exam was conducted in pen and paper-based mode in two shifts. During the exam, the Board made adequate arrangements to ensure that all the candidates followed the COVID-19 guidelines.

Minimum Qualifying Marks for KTET 2021

  • General category candidates need to obtain a minimum of 60 per cent marks, that is, 90 out of 150 marks to qualify for the KTET exam. On the other hand, candidates belonging to reserved categories such as SC, ST, OBC need to secure 55 per cent marks, that is, 82 out of 150 marks.
  • Candidates who can secure equal to or more than these qualifying marks will be declared as Kerala Teacher Eligibility Test (KTET) qualified. Check out the details of the passing percentage and marks in the table mentioned below:

Category

Passing Marks

Minimum Qualifying Percentage

General

90 out of 150

60%

OBC/SC/ST

82 out of 150

55%
